What $SUBJECT series proposed was indeed a "mega function", but one that was just a list of function calls with no error checking or recovery, and no documentation/description about dependencies/sequencing etc. etc. Based on the patches at hadn (which is all reviewers have to go on), notifiers seemed to be a good fit. If there are good reasons that all of the device-off events need to be coordinated/synchronized/sequenced (and it sounds like there are, thanks for pointing them out), I am not opposed to that approach. It simply needs to be well described in the changlog. Thanks, Kevin
